Rwanda has redefined itself as one of Africa’s most forward-looking countries, with a strong reputation for safety, order, and innovation. For international students, it offers a modern academic environment supported by respected institutions such as the University of Rwanda, Carnegie Mellon University Africa, and the African Leadership University.
English is widely used in higher education, making Rwanda especially attractive for regional and international students. Kigali in particular has become known for its clean infrastructure, modern services, and organized city planning, which supports a focused and professional student lifestyle.
Beyond academics, Rwanda stands out for its culture of responsibility, public safety, and growing startup ecosystem. It is an excellent destination for students interested in Software Engineering, Business, Leadership, Development Studies, and Sustainability.

Monthly Budget
Rwanda offers a practical and manageable student lifestyle compared with many larger global education destinations. A budget of $300 – $550 USD per month is often enough for a comfortable student life in Kigali, depending on accommodation choices.
